Professional Background
Nicole Sloane is a distinguished HR transformation project manager with a commendable track record in employee benefit accounting, payroll, domestic relocation, global mobility, broad-based and executive compensation, and global equity administration. She demonstrates extensive expertise derived from her broad professional experience, notably with Kimberly-Clark, where she has excelled in various human resources roles. Nicole's journey reflects her deep commitment to advancing organizational efficiency and enhancing the employee experience through strategic HR initiatives.
In her notable capacity at Kimberly-Clark, Nicole advanced through several key roles, showing her versatility and adept leadership. Launched as a Benefits Accounting professional, she skillfully navigated to Payroll Manager, demonstrating a keen understanding of payroll operations and employee compensation. Her journey through the ranks continued with significant responsibilities as Payroll & Domestic & Global Mobility Manager, where she integrated the complexities of diverse relocation and mobility services into the overall HR framework. As a Compensation Consultant, she played a pivotal role in shaping compensation strategies that balanced organizational objectives with employee wellness and satisfaction.
Nicole also held the prestigious position of Global Stock Plan Manager, overseeing the administration of stock plans for employees worldwide. This role placed her at the intersection of strategic decision-making and broad-based compensation, allowing her to influence organizational culture positively while aligning employee aspirations with the company’s financial goals.
In addition to her corporate responsibilities, Nicole has also served on the Board of Directors for the Global Equity Organization, where she previously held the role of Chair. Her leadership of this esteemed organization was marked by her strategic oversight and governance, propelling the discussion on global equity practices and cultivating a community of industry influencers. Currently, as an active board member, she continues to drive thought leadership and innovation in the rapidly evolving landscape of global equity.

Education and Achievements
Nicole's academic background is as impressive as her professional journey. She has pursued further education at prestigious institutions, strengthening her knowledge base in equity and business administration.
- Certified Equity Professional: Nicole studied at the Leavey School of Business at Santa Clara University, enhancing her ability to manage and advise on employee equity plans in a global context.
- Master of Business Administration Coursework: She took courses at Auburn University, reinforcing her management practices and business acumen, essential for her roles in human resources and organizational development.
- Bachelor of Science in Accounting: Nicole earned her degree from Carson-Newman University, establishing her strong foundation in accounting principles that inform much of her work in HR and employee compensation.
